- The Process: Start to FinishRural farmers in the hills of the Himalayan region have limited access to resources, markets, and capital. Poor road conditions, long journeys to city center and the cost of equipment/expansion prevents many rural farmers from commercializing their harvests. - Togetherness: Japanese Embassy, Pyuthan Municipality, and VolNepalThe Japanese Embassy and Volunteer Nepal National Group (VolNepal), a non-profit organization based in Kathmandu, have joined forces to bring about positive change in Pyuthan District, Nepal.
